How much do farm ranch man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for farm ranch manager in Dallas, TX is $58,648.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,100.00 and $67,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Farm Ranch Manager job?

A Farm Ranch Manager is responsible for overseeing the daily operations of a farm or ranch, ensuring productivity and profitability. Duties include managing livestock, crops, employees, equipment, and budgeting. They implement best agricultural practices, monitor market trends, and comply with regulations.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and knowledge of farming techniques are essential for success in this role.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Farm Ranch Manager?

Farm Ranch Managers typically oversee daily operations such as managing planting and harvesting schedules, supervising staff, maintaining equipment, caring for livestock, and ensuring compliance with agriculture regulations. They may also handle budgeting, inventory management, and coordinate activities with agronomists, suppliers, or veterinarians. The role often involves hands-on work outdoors, as well as administrative tasks in an office setting. Managing these varied responsibilities requires flexibility and strong organizational skills to ensure that farm operations run smoothly and efficiently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Farm Ranch Manager position, and why are they important?

A Farm Ranch Manager needs strong agricultural knowledge, business management skills, and hands-on experience in crop and livestock operations, typically acquired through a degree in agriculture or related field and several years of practical farm work. Familiarity with equipment maintenance, budgeting software, farm management systems, and, in some cases, certifications like a pesticide applicator license are also valuable. Excellent leadership, problem-solving, and communication abilities distinguish top performers, as they must coordinate staff and adapt to changing conditions. These skills are critical for optimizing productivity, ensuring farm compliance, and maintaining a profitable agricultural operation.

Position Overview
We are seeking a competitive, high-energy Sourcing Manager who enjoys building relationships, solving problems, and help drive winning sourcing outcomes. The Sourcing Manager is responsible for executing sourcing initiatives across Mid-States' six business divisions. This role works cross-functionally with internal teams and external suppliers to support product development, vendor performance, cost analysis, process improvement, and strategic sourcing decisions.
Key Responsibilities
  • Collect, analyze, benchmark, and report on category product development activity.
  • Identify, source, and develop supplier relationships that support company goals.
  • Obtain and compare multiple supplier quotes to support sourcing recommendations.
  • Assist in negotiating price, quantity, quality expectations, and delivery lead times.
  • Review, improve, and create sourcing process documents and tools as needed.
    • Project tracking (stage gate)
    • FOB to ELC cost analysis
    • Evaluate services provided by suppliers
  • Finding, establishing, fostering relationships, and assessing elements of the supplier/factory base
  • Obtain quotes from different suppliers/factories
  • Ensure data accuracy and specification of materials and services being sourced/procured
  • Provide customer relationship support
  • Tracking projects & vendor performance
  • Help define, execute, and support strategic sourcing and procurement decisions
  • Continuous improvement to processes and procedures
  • Assist with negotiating price, quantity, and lead times
  • Review and build pricing and cost comparison documents to aid in decision making
  • Facilitate and participate in cross-functional team meetings through the Stage Gate Process tool
  • Perform value analysis optimization - costs, specifications, MOQ's, and quality, to determine best supplier(s) decision n recommendation.
  • Learn and build your own product knowledge by facilitating the RFQ process documentation with merchants.
  • Serve as the key liaison within the sourcing department, working closely with the VP of Sourcing, sourcing specialists, suppliers, factories, commercialization team, and internal support departments.

Minimum Qualifications, Skills, and Experience
  • Bachelor's degree in business, administration, purchasing, logistics, supply chain, or a related field; equivalent professional experience may be considered.
  • Proven experience supporting sourcing, procurement, supplier management, or product development processes. Experience in retail or distribution operations.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ications.
  • Strong understanding of sourcing methodologies and supplier evaluation practices.
  • Foundational knowledge of freight, duties, tariffs, freight, landed cost, and related cost drivers.
  • Working in a dynamic, rapidly changing business environment
  • Ability to maintain a flexible schedule to accommodate occasional early morning or evening calls with partners in Southeast Asia.
  • Strong negotiation skills
  • Sound time-management and organizational skills
  • Superior quantitative and qualitative analytical skills
  • Retail, consumer products, or consumer-facing experience preferred.

Travel
International travel is required. This role typically includes up to 3-4 international trips per year, with each trip lasting approximately 14-19 days.
